3 goals, 39 seconds: Hurricanes get back into Game 3 with record scoring barrage

After watching Mitch Marner record the fastest hat trick in Stanley Cup Final history, the Carolina Hurricanes set a speed record of their own.Carolina scored three goals in the span of just 39 seconds in the third period, turning a 4-0 Vegas blowout into a 4-3 nail biter. Per Sportsnet Stats, that's the fastest any team has scored three goals in a Stanley Cup Final game.
